    Ananda K. Coomaraswamy, seeing beyond the unsurpassed rhythm, beauty, power and grace of the Nataraja, once wrote of it “It is the clearest image of the activity of God which any art or religion can boast of.”

    More recently, Fritjof Capra explained that “Modern physics has shown that the rhythm of creation and destruction is not only manifest in the turn of the seasons and in the birth and death of all living creatures, but is also the very essence of inorganic matter,” and that “For the modern physicists, then, Shiva’s dance is the dance of subatomic matter.”

    It is indeed as Capra concluded: “Hundreds of years ago, Indian artists created visual images of dancing Shivas in a beautiful series of bronzes. In our time, physicists have used the most advanced technology to portray the patterns of the cosmic dance. The metaphor of the cosmic dance thus unifies ancient mythology, religious art and modern physics.”

    The existence of the Higgs boson was predicted in 1964 to explain the Higgs mechanism (sometimes termed in the literature the Brout–Englert–Higgs, BEH or Brout–Englert–Higgs–Hagen–Guralnik–Kibble mechanism after its original proposers[7])—the mechanism by which elementary particles are given mass.[Note 2] While the Higgs mechanism is considered confirmed to exist, the boson itself—a cornerstone of the leading theory—had not been observed and its existence was unconfirmed. Its tentative discovery in July 2012 may validate the Standard Model as essentially correct, as it is the final elementary particle predicted and required by the Standard Model which had not yet been observed via particle physics experiments.[8] Alternative sources of the Higgs mechanism that do not need the Higgs boson also are possible and would be considered if the existence of the Higgs boson were to be ruled out. They are known as Higgsless models.

    The Higgs boson is named after Peter Higgs, who in 1964 wrote one of three ground-breaking papers alongside the work of Robert Brout and François Englert and Tom KibbleC. R. Hagen andGerald Guralnik covering what is now known as the Higgs mechanism and described the related Higgs field and boson.

    Technically, it is the quantum excitation of the Higgs field, and the non-zero value of the ground state of this field, that give mass to the other elementary particles, such as quarks and electrons. The Standard Model completely fixes the properties of the Higgs boson, except for its mass. It is expected to have no spin and no electric or colour charge, and it interacts with other particles through the weak interaction and Yukawa-type interactions between the various fermions and the Higgs field.

    Because the Higgs boson is a very massive particle and decays almost immediately when created, only a very high-energy particle accelerator can observe and record it. Experiments to confirm and determine the nature of the Higgs boson using the Large Hadron Collider (LHC) at CERN began in early 2010, and were performed at Fermilab‘s Tevatron until its close in late 2011. Mathematical consistency of the Standard Model requires that any mechanism capable of generating the masses of elementary particles become visible at energies above 1.4 TeV;[9] therefore, the LHC (designed to collide two 7 TeV proton beams, but currently running at 4 TeV each) was built to answer the question of whether or not the Higgs boson exists.[10]

    On 4 July 2012, the two main experiments at the LHC (ATLAS and CMS) both reported independently the confirmed existence of a previously unknown particle with a mass of about 125 GeV/c2(about 133 proton masses, on the order of 10−25 kg), which is “consistent with the Higgs boson” and widely believed to be the Higgs boson. They cautioned that further work would be needed to confirm that it is indeed the Higgs boson (meaning that it has the theoretically predicted properties of the Higgs boson and is not some other previously unknown particle) and, if so, to determine which version of the Standard Model it best supports.[1][2][3][11][12]

    Levity apart ,Vaisheshika system of Indian Philosophy throws some insight into this.

    Vaisheshika system of Indian Philosophy postulates Atomic Theory.

    It has recognized the existence of Atoms at the level we come to know of them to-day.
    It also explains how they combine with each others to produce a Molecule, and later objects. 

    Fundamentally all objects can be reduced into Atoms.

    Each Atom is unique(visesha).

    When one combines with another ,similar in Nature (not identical), they together form a Binary..

    These Atoms in the Binary are conjoined ;but the Binary in relation to these Atoms are not only conjoined with them but the relationship is something more, that is what makes the whole different from the parts.That is to say, the Binary is conjoined ,yet not conjoined. The whole is the Sum of its parts and something more.

    The Vaisheshika call this unique properties of Atoms when they conjoin to produce a Binary as ‘Samavaya’.

    If one were to remove the threads of a piece of cloth one by one ,at the end the Cloth will become non-existent.

    This is the relation spoken of here.

    Three Binaries produce a ‘Triad’ which are the fundamental particles to Matter as we see them.

    The Triads are related to the Binaries as ‘Samavaya’

    This special attribute is what makes up the Universe.

    The Higgs boson (sometimes nicknamed the “God particle” in popular media) is a hypothetical massive elementary particle that is predicted to exist by theStandard Model (SM) of particle physics. The Higgs boson is an integral part of the theoretical Higgs mechanism. If shown to exist, it would help explain why other particles can have mass.[Note 2] It is the only predicted elementary particle that has not yet been observed in particle physics experiments.[1]Theories that do not need the Higgs boson also exist and would be considered if the existence of the Higgs Boson was ruled out. They are described asHiggsless models.

    If shown to exist, the Higgs mechanism would also explain why the W and Z bosons, which mediate weak interactions, are massive whereas the relatedphoton, which mediates electromagnetism, is massless. The Higgs boson is expected to be in a class of particles known as scalar bosons. (Bosons are particles with integer spin, and scalar bosons have spin 0.)

    Experiments attempting to find the particle are currently being performed using the Large Hadron Collider (LHC) at CERN, and were performed at Fermilab’sTevatron until its closure in late 2011. Some theories suggest that any mechanism capable of generating the masses of elementary particles must be visible at energies below 1.4 TeV; therefore, the LHC is expected to be able to provide experimental evidence of the existence or non-existence of the Higgs boson.

    On 12 December 2011, the ATLAS collaboration at the LHC found that a Higgs mass in the range from 145 to 206 GeV was excluded at the 95% confidence level. On 13 December 2011, experimental results were announced from the ATLAS and CMS experiments, suggesting that if the Higgs Boson exists, it is probably limited to a range of 115–130 GeV at the 3.6 sigma level (ATLAS) or 117–127 GeV at the 2.6 sigma level (CMS), and indicating possible scope for a 124 GeV (CMS) or 125-126 GeV (ATLAS) Higgs. As of 13 December 2011, a joint estimate is not available.
